site stats

Binary tree preorder traversal iterative

WebDepending on the order in which we do this, there can be three types of traversal. Inorder traversal First, visit all the nodes in the left subtree Then the root node Visit all the nodes in the right subtree inorder(root->left) … WebNov 27, 2016 · Given a binary tree, write an iterative and recursive solution to traverse the tree using preorder traversal in C++, Java, and Python. Unlike linked lists, one …

Solved There are generally considered to be four distinct - Chegg

WebThe front, middle, and post-sequential traversal of binary trees and find-Java implementation The key to seizing too much about traversal, the key to finding related ideas is how to achieve the order of the search and the return of results; WebUnderstanding the below given iterative traversals can be a little tricky so the best way to understand them is to work them out on a piece of paper. Use this sample binary tree and follow the steps of the below given codes. In Order Traversal: The in order traversal requires that we print the leftmost node first and the right most node at the end. ph of lube oil https://antiguedadesmercurio.com

Preorder Traversal Practice GeeksforGeeks

WebThis video explains how to perform Preorder tree traversal or iterative preorder traversal without recursion. Show more Show more WebMar 20, 2024 · void Tree::n_preorder() { Node* node; stack nodeStack; cout << "\nPreorder:"; nodeStack.push(root); while (!nodeStack.isEmpty()) { node = … WebJul 16,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. ttt x wing

Binary Tree PreOrder Traversal in Java - Recursion …

Category:Stackless pre-order traversal in a binary tree - Stack …

Tags:Binary tree preorder traversal iterative

Binary tree preorder traversal iterative

Triple Order Traversal of a Binary Tree - GeeksforGeeks

WebThe traversal can be done iteratively where the deferred nodes are stored in the stack, or it can be done by recursion, where the deferred nodes are stored implicitly in the call stack. For traversing a (non-empty) binary tree in an inorder fashion, we must do these three things for every node n starting from the tree’s root: WebJun 17, 2024 · Iterative Preorder Traversal. Given a Binary Tree, write an iterative function to print the Preorder traversal of the given binary tree. Refer to this for recursive preorder traversal of Binary Tree. To convert an inherently recursive procedure to … Time Complexity: O(N) Auxiliary Space: If we don’t consider the size of the stack … Time Complexity: O(n), we visit every node at most once. Auxiliary Space: O(1), we …

Binary tree preorder traversal iterative

Did you know?

WebWhich. There are generally considered to be four distinct binary tree traversals: preorder, inorder, postorder and level-order. Consider the following questions about these different … WebGiven below is the algorithm of Preorder Traversal: Step 1: Visit the root node. Step 2: Traverse the left sub tree, i.e., traverse recursively. Step 3: Traverse the right sub tree, …

WebDepth-first traversal (dotted path) of a binary tree: Pre-order (node visited at position red ): F, B, A, D, C, E, G, I, H; In-order (node visited at position green ): A, B, C, D, E, F, G, H, I; Post-order (node visited at position blue ): A, C, E, D, B, H, I, G, F. WebJul 5, 2024 · Binary Tree for Pre-order Traversal. The nodes in yellow are not yet visited, and the subtrees with dashed edges are also not visited yet. The pre-order traversal visits the nodes A, B, D, G, E, H ...

WebAsked In: Given a binary tree, return the preorder traversal of its nodes’ values. Example : Given binary tree 1 \ 2 / 3 return [1,2,3]. Using recursion is not allowed. Note: You only need to implement the given function. Do not read input, instead use the arguments to the function. Do not print the output, instead return values as specified. Web3.Stocktransfer between two plants without delivery (MM STO): Thisprocess is also called as MM STO, but many of the companies will use intra orinter process because of …

WebGiven a binary tree, find its preorder traversal. Example 1: Input: 1 / 4 / \ 4 &amp;

WebYour task is to complete the function preOrder () which takes the root of the tree as input and returns a list containing the preorder traversal of the tree, calculated without using … ph of lysosomeWebMar 28, 2024 · Given a binary tree, traversal the binary tree using inorder traversal, so the left child is visited first, and then node and then right child. Write an iterative solution as a practice of depth first search. Algorithm ph of london tap waterWebOct 11,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. ph of lymphWebSep 7, 2016 · Java Program to traverse the binary tree using InOrder algorithm Here is our complete Java program to implement iterative inorder traversal in Java. Similar to the iterative PreOrder algorithm we have used the Stack data structure to convert the recursive algorithm to an iterative one, one of the important things every programmer should … ph of litmus paperWebDec 6, 2014 · we can traverse the binary search tree through recursion like: void traverse1 (node t) { if ( t != NULL) { visit (t); traverse1 (t->left); traverse1 (t->right); } } and also through loop ( with stack) like: ph of lipidsWebDec 1, 2024 · Solution 1: Iterative Intuition: In preorder traversal, the tree is traversed in this way: root, left, right. When we visit a node, we print its value, and then we want to visit the left child followed by the right child. The fundamental problem we face in this scenario is that there is no way that we can move from a child to a parent. tttx-itn-rtmWebJul 16,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and … tttxw1419 126.com